Crossroads Recuces Workforce

Jul 12, 2001

Crossroads Systems Inc. , a global provider of connectivity for storage networking solutions, today announced a workforce reduction.


In order to reduce its operating expenses, the company has eliminated approximately 10 percent of its workforce, or approximately 20 employees, through realignment and consolidation of its current organization. The company says no software or hardware engineering positions were affected in its core router business unit.


Crossroads’ President and Chief Operating Officer Larry Sanders said, “We believe that this action is a prudent cost reduction measure taken in response to the current uncertain economic and market environments. It was imperative that we lower our break-even point in order to reinforce our commitment to achieving profitability.”
